The following data represent a sample of 10 scores on a 20-point statistics quiz: 16, 16, 16, 16, 16, 18, 18, 20, 20, and 20 . After the mean, median, range and variance were calculated for the scores, it was discovered that one of the scores of 20 should have been an 18 . Which of the following will change when the calculations are redone using the correct scores?
 a. mean and range
  b. median and range
  c. mean and variance
  d. range and variance
  e. mean, range, median and variance

A serious new warning has been established for pregnant women against taking ACE inhibitors during pregnancy. In the study, the risk of major birth defects in children whose mothers took ACE inhibitors during the first trimester was nearly three times higher than in children whose mothers didn't take ACE inhibitors. Physicians can prescribe alternative medications for pregnant women who have symptoms of high blood pressure.
